    I don't agree with you about the navigation, progression or combat. I can see the argument for imbalance, but I'm not sure it negatively affects the play experience. Though I don't pvp. The pve enemies can deal insane damage, but you can turn yourself into a truly OP beast in half a dozen different ways, and things like the ash summons and NPC cooperators let you turn almost any boss fight into a gank squad where you almost can't lose. The controls are what they are. Outside of some dropped inputs, which while unfortunate didn't fundamentally damn me any more than my other mistakes did, I find them to be largely deliberate and effective.

    Honestly? It's easily one of the best games FromSoft has ever produced. Far from perfect? Sure. Maybe not as technically mind blowing as Bloodborne or Sekiro, but the sheer scope of what was attempted here is worthy of praise, and the execution is surprisingly effective. The lore is excellent, the challenge is there if you are looking for it. And, quite frankly, the view from the East Capital Rampart site of grace when you first reach Leyndell may be one of the most beautiful things I've ever seen in a game. Not just for the sheer, overwhelming visual of the golden capital, but because YOU CAN GO TO EVERYTHING YOU CAN SEE.

    I'm 65 hours in, working my way up the Mountaintop of the Giants just this afternoon. The difficulty spike coming out of Leyndell is no joke. I went from feeling OP and just a bit over-leveled in the Capitol to hitting like a wet noodle and having to up my dodge game all over again. But I have loved almost every minute of it. I'm easily going to hit 100 hours in this thing, and that's without NG+.

    Quote Originally Posted by charliehustle415 View Post
    okay I'll them them out, right now I am dex, intelligence build it's workng out pretty well for now; but I wanna pump more into strength and vigor
    Vigor is totally worth the investment. At least 40, maybe even 50 depending on your style.

    But I'd hesitate to invest in a third damage stat any more than you have to. An easy way to leave yourself spread thin. And several mid game bosses are a lot easier if you can kill them quickly rather than a long, drawn out battle because your damage is low.
